A $40 backpack is in sale for $28. What is the % of change

Respuesta :

xEngineerOrg
xEngineerOrg xEngineerOrg
  • 02-01-2017
$ 40 ..... 100 %
$ 28 ..... x %

[tex]x = \frac{28 \cdot 100}{40} = 70[/tex]

The % of change is 70 %.

This is equivalent with:
- the final price ($ 28) is 70 % from the initial price ($ 40)
- the initial price ($ 40) was reduced with 30% giving the new price as:
[tex]40 - 40 \cdot \frac{30}{100} = 28[/tex]
